自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(24)
  • 收藏
  • 关注

原创 Nginx和FastDFS的整合

一个好的分布式文件系统最好提供Nginx的模块,因为对于互联网应用来说,像文件这种静态资源,一般是通过HTTP的下载,此时通过容易扩展的Nginx来访问FastDFS,能够让文件的上传和下载变得特别简单。

2023-11-25 15:13:54 1072

原创 实验3 数据包的捕获及分析

熟悉网络数据包分析工具Wireshark(Ethereal)的主要功能,掌握常用协议的数据包捕获及分析方法。

2023-11-23 22:29:37 1043

原创 FastCGI的学习

FastCGI快速通用网关接口(Fast Common Gateway Interface/FastCGI)是一种让交互程序与Web服务器通信的协议

2023-11-23 00:13:50 137

原创 Nginx服务器学习

Nginx是一款轻量级的Web 服务器、反向代理服务器、电子邮件(IMAP/POP3)代理服务器,并在一个BSD-like 协议下发行。由俄罗斯的程序设计师Igor Sysoev使用c语言开发,供俄国大型的入口网站及搜索引擎Rambler(俄文:Рамблер)使用。其特点是占有内存少,并发能力强,事实上nginx的并发能力确实在同类型的网页服务器中表现较好,中国大陆使用nginx网站用户有:百度、京东、新浪、网易、腾讯、淘宝等。Nginx能干什么?

2023-11-22 15:26:12 34

原创 非关系型数据库Redis学习

Redis 是一个强大的内存数据结构存储,用作数据库、缓存和消息代理。

2023-11-20 23:52:49 69 1

原创 分布式文件系统FastDFS的学习

FastDFS是一款开源的分布式文件系统,功能主要包括:文件存储、文件同步、文件访问(文件上传、文件下载)等,解决了文件大容量存储和高性能访问的问题。FastDFS特别适合以文件为载体的在线服务,如图片、视频、文档等等服务。

2023-11-19 22:12:34 181

原创 Linux基本命令

本文详细描述了关于Linux操作系统中常见的命令,以及如何使用的案例

2023-11-18 20:27:44 62 1

原创 Linux网络学习之libevent

libevent...event_base...buffer_event等等

2023-11-16 22:18:32 205 1

原创 Linux网络学习之本地套接字通信(Unix Domain Socket)

本文描述了关于IPC本地套接字进行进程间通信的概念

2023-11-16 16:39:06 401 1

原创 Linux网络学习之UDP和组播

本文写的是关于UDP协议以及多播(组播)相关的概念

2023-11-16 16:35:49 646 1

原创 Linux网络学习之线程池并发服务器

线程池相关的概念,以及实现的简单和复杂版本的线程池,难度较高

2023-11-15 16:47:13 51

原创 Linux网络学习之高并发服务器模型

本文主要介绍Linux操作系统中的多路IO模型select,poll以及epoll和相应的epoll反应堆

2023-11-12 18:42:11 58

原创 Linux网络学习之多进程/线程实现高并发服务器

在Linux下使用多进程以及多线程实现高并发服务器(包含客户端,可以直接编译)

2023-11-09 20:05:21 155 1

原创 Linux网络学习之TCP相关概念

Linux操作系统下TCP协议栈的相关知识

2023-11-08 00:31:07 43 1

原创 Linux网络学习之socket编程

使用Socket套接字进行进程间通信的一些概念以及大小端字节序等

2023-11-05 21:33:18 29

原创 Linux网络基础概念

Linux网络中的一些基础概念,包括协议、分层模型等

2023-11-04 15:34:09 56 1

原创 Linux学习之线程下

Linux中线程的进阶知识,线程同步,互斥锁,条件变量,信号量异以及生产者消费者模型等概念

2023-11-04 12:25:34 27 1

原创 Linux学习之线程上

Linux中线程的基本概念,包括线程介绍、线程相关函数以及线程属性等知识

2023-11-02 20:45:01 30 1

原创 Linux进程之守护进程

Linux进程中守护进程的一些基本概念

2023-11-02 16:58:59 33 1

原创 Linux进程间通信之信号

Linux进程间通信之信号的相关概念

2023-11-01 19:32:03 58 1

原创 Linux进程间通信之管道和内存映射

Linux进程通信的方式以及管道和存储映射区的学习

2023-10-28 15:38:24 126 1

原创 Linux学习之进程基础知识

Linux学习之进程基础知识

2023-10-26 21:07:21 24

原创 Linux学习之文件IO

​ 在学习Linux各种系统函数之前,我们需要先熟练掌握c语言。因为这些系统函数的用法必须结合Linux内核的工作原理来理解,而内核也是由c语言编写的,我们在描述内核工作原理时必然要用到"指针",“结构体”,“链表”这些名词来组织语言,所以在学习Linux系统函数之前,有良好的c语言基础才能更深一步了解到内核的工作原理。

2023-10-24 22:10:18 44

原创 指针和引用

指针是一种特殊的,注意是变量,而不是一种数据类型。和内存中对应的。而指针这种变量同样有它的属性和地址,不过它的值是另一个变量在内存中的地址,当然它自身也有自己的地址。比如:对于int数据类型,int* 类型的变量就是一个指针类型,它的值对应的就是int类型变量的地址。同样:对于T类型,T* 类型变量的值就能够存储T类型的地址。(因为每一种数据类型在内存中的地址长度是不一样的,所以指针这种变量的值不能用于保存其他数据类型的地址)

2023-10-15 18:26:34 25 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除